Rare Polish hohlpfennig with a representation of a crown topped with a cross in the form of a pole flanked by two balls.
Coin classified by Borys Paszkiewicz as a non-Teutonic (Polish) imitation of Teutonic bracteats of the Crown I type, Paszkiewicz T6, which are dated to the years ca. 1287/1288-1297/1298. The imitation may have a similar chronology or the coins are a bit younger.
Diameter 15 mm, weight 0.21 g
